Congressional Sports for Charity
This grant will support Congressional Sports for Charity, organizer of the annual Congressional Baseball Game. The Congressional Baseball Game, first held in 1909, is an annual bipartisan event in which Members of the United States Congress face off in a friendly baseball game. Congressional Sports for Charity uses proceeds from the game to support charities across the Washington, DC area.

POPVOX LegiDash Fund
The POPVOX LegiDash Fund, a project of the Tides Foundation, will develop a communications and legislative resources dashboard for use by congressional staff. The free product, called LegiDash, will provide staff with an improved constituent communications portal they can use to view and respond to messages delivered to Congress by POPVOX, increasing the efficiency of that process.

Nonprofit Vote
To provide support for Nonprofit VOTE’s coordination of their National Voter Registration Day (NVRD) project. Nonprofit VOTE will work to recruit and empower local partners to participate in NVRD and register voters, while simultaneously launching a national media campaign to amplify those efforts.
